Abstract

Latar Belakang: Tingginya angka kejadian kanker kolorektal mendorong perkembangan pengetahuan mengenai kanker kolorektal, salah satunya mengenai tumor associated macrophage (TAM). TAM merupakan makrofag yang ditemukan dalam lingkungan mikro tumor dan dibagi menjadi 2 sub tipe M1 dan M2. Infiltrasi TAM akan mempengaruhi pertumbuhan ukuran serta akan berdampak pada stadium kanker yang lebih lanjut sehingga dicanangkan menjadi indikator prognosis pada kanker kolorektal. Tujuan: Mengetahui hubungan tumor associated macrophage dengan ukuran dan stadium kanker pada pasien adenokarsinoma kolorektal. Metode: Analitik observasional dengan pendekatan cross sectional menggunakan data sekunder. Sampel penelitian ini adalah 37 pasien adenokarsinoma kolorektal. Analisis statistik dengan uji Spearman. Hasil: Hasil dari analisis SPSS 25.0 didapatkan nilai sebesar 0,768 (p>0,05) untuk hubungan TAM dan klasifikasi “T” dan nilai sebesar 0,026 (p<0,05) untuk hubungan TAM dan stadium klinis. Kesimpulan: Tidak terdapat hubungan yang signifikan antara TAM dan klasifikasi “T” dan terdapat korelasi positif antara TAM dengan stadium klinis pada adenokarsinoma kolorektal.

Abstract

Objective: to determine the degree of expression of Fibroblast Activation Protein in Cancer Associated Fibroblasts of colorectal carcinoma. Methods: descriptive study with a cross sectional research design. Using 36 paraffin blocks of CRC cases that met the inclusion criteria. FAP expression was assessed through immunohistochemical staining with anti-FAP and histopathological data were recorded in the form of depth invasion, degree of differentiation, lymphovascular invasion and lymph node metastatic status. Results: FAP in CAFs showed a high expression in most cases (52.8%). High-grade expression of FAP more common at T3-T4 depth of invasion, low-grade differentiation, CRC without lymphovascular invasion and CRC without lymph node metastases. Conclusion: there are variations in the expression of FAP as a marker of CAFs in colorectal carcinoma histopathology features.

Abstract

Latar belakang: Neutrophil-to-Lymphocyte Ratio (NLR) dipertimbangkan sebagai penanda inflamasi untuk menilai derajat klinis COVID-19 pada anak, namun data lokal masih terbatas.Objektif: Menilai hubungan antara gejala/derajat klinis dengan NLR pada anak dengan COVID-19.Metode: Studi analitik korelatif dengan desain potong lintang menggunakan data rekam medis sekunder pasien pediatrik terkonfirmasi COVID-19 yang dirawat di ruang isolasi RS H. Abdul Manap, Kota Jambi, Januari–Juli 2021. Variabel utama: derajat klinis dan NLR (cut-off 3,13). Analisis menggunakan uji korelasi serta estimasi kekuatan hubungan.Hasil: Mayoritas pasien berjenis kelamin laki-laki (55,1%), berderajat klinis ringan (87,7%), dan memiliki NLR <3,13 (98%). Terdapat korelasi lemah namun bermakna antara derajat klinis (ringan–sedang) dan NLR (r=0,386; p=0,006).Kesimpulan: Derajat klinis COVID-19 pada anak berkorelasi lemah tetapi signifikan dengan NLR, dengan sebagian besar kasus ringan menunjukkan NLR <3,13. NLR berpotensi sebagai penanda pendukung stratifikasi klinis; diperlukan penelitian prospektif dengan ukuran sampel memadai untuk memvalidasi temuan ini.

Abstract

Latar Belakang: Teknik operasi bedah basis kranii dengan pendekatan endoskopi transfenoid memberikan kualitas visualisasi lapang pandang operasi lebih baik dibanding menggunakan mikroskop dan morbiditas lebih rendah dibanding teknik lainnya. Selama dua dekade terakhir bedah endoskopik telah mendapatkan dukungan sebagai pendekatan utama untuk lesi sellar dan parasellar termasuk adenoma hipofisis. Laporan Kasus: Dilaporkan satu kasus seorang laki-laki 34 tahun dengan keluhan penurunan penglihatan dan didiagnosis dengan adenoma hipofisis. Pada pasien dilakukan tindakan reseksi tumor oleh ahli bedah saraf dengan pendekatan endoskopi transfenoid berkolaborasi dengan ahli THT-KL. Kesimpulan: Bedah basis kranii pendekatan endoskopi transfenoid adalah tindakan bedah yang menjadi pilihan utama untuk lesi basis kranii. Tindakan ini memberikan visualisasi struktur anatomi yang baik, lapang pandang operasi yang lebih luas, manipulasi struktur neurovaskular minimal, meminimalisir morbiditas dan meningkatkan kualitas hidup pasien, memiliki tingkat keberhasilan yang cukup tinggi dan memberikan hasil yang memuaskan.

Abstract

Background: Childhood malnutrition stems from inadequate intake and disease; synbiotics (probiotics+prebiotics) can modulate gut microbiota and immune function, aligning with SDG-3 targets through cost-effective prophylaxis and immunomodulation. Objective: To evaluate onion (Allium cepa Linn.)-derived inulin combined with probiotic-rich Sumatran dadih as supportive therapy for pediatric malnutrition. Methods: Narrative literature review of human and relevant preclinical studies on synbiotics, inulin, dadih, gut microbiota, and immune modulation, with selection based on relevance and methodological quality. Results: Evidence suggests synbiotics improve microbiota diversity, short-chain fatty acid production, nutrient absorption, and reduce inflammation and infection rates. Onion-inulin functions as a fermentable prebiotic; dadih provides robust local lactic-acid bacteria strains. Yet data are heterogeneous, sample sizes small, and dosing/formulation poorly standardized; safety reporting is variable. Conclusion: An onion-inulin + dadih synbiotic is a plausible, context-appropriate adjuvant for managing childhood malnutrition. Rigorous, controlled trials should optimize dose, strain selection, and formulation, and confirm efficacy and safety for scalable implementation.

Abstract

Latar belakang: Prevalensi skabies di lingkungan pesantren Indonesia tetap tinggi dan berdampak pada kesehatan serta proses belajar.Objektif: Menilai faktor yang memengaruhi kejadian skabies, kekuatan hubungan masing-masing faktor, dan faktor paling dominan di pesantren.Metode: Studi potong lintang observasional kuantitatif di Pesantren Darunna’im Yapia, Warujaya–Parung, Bogor (2023). Responden santri usia 12–18 tahun (n=74). Analisis menggunakan uji Chi-Square dan regresi logistik biner.Hasil: Terdapat hubungan bermakna antara jenis kelamin (p=0,004; OR 4,4299), tingkat usia (p<0,001; OR 19,556), tingkat pendidikan (p=0,007; OR 4,000), dan personal hygiene (p=0,003; OR 7,931) dengan kejadian skabies. Pada analisis multivariat, tingkat usia merupakan prediktor paling dominan (p=0,036; Exp(B) 11,744). Keempat faktor secara simultan menjelaskan 41,4% variabilitas kejadian skabies.Kesimpulan: Kejadian skabies di pesantren dipengaruhi oleh jenis kelamin, usia, pendidikan, dan personal hygiene; usia adalah faktor paling dominan. Temuan ini menekankan perlunya intervensi terarah pada kelompok usia berisiko, disertai penguatan higiene pribadi dan tata kelola asrama.

Abstract

Background: Colorectal cancer is closely linked to chronic inflammation; long-standing colitis confers a 2–3-fold higher risk. Modulating the gut–immune axis with probiotics may attenuate the inflammatory microenvironment of colitis-associated colorectal cancer (CAC). Objective:To evaluate the anti-inflammatory effects of probiotics in CAC animal models. Methods: We searched PubMed, ScienceDirect, and Wiley Online Library; 248 records were screened and 9 studies met inclusion. Risk of bias was appraised using SYRCLE RoB. Results: Probiotic treatment consistently reduced clinical severity, down-regulated inflammatory markers, and modulated key signaling pathways in CAC models. Nonetheless, evidence was heterogeneous, sample sizes were small, and dosing, strains, and formulations varied; safety reporting was limited. Conclusions: Probiotics show promise as anti-inflammatory adjuncts in CAC based on animal studies. Rigorous, standardized preclinical work and well-designed trials are needed to define optimal strains, dosing, and formulations, and to confirm efficacy and safety for translation.

Abstract

Objective: This research aims to develop a biscuit formulation with the substitution of mackerel fish flour and black rice flour as an alternative snack for diabetes mellitus sufferers.Method: This research was an experiment with a Completely Randomized Design (CRD) consisting of four treatments, namely 0% (F0), 25% (F1), 50% (F2), and 75% (F3). Organoleptic tests were carried out on 7 trained panelists. The organoleptic test data was tested for normality using the Shapiro Wilk test. The results of the data distribution are normally distributed, so to determine whether there are real differences in each treatment, the data is processed using the ANOVA test at the 5% level, if it is known that there are significant differences (p value <0.05), followed by the Duncan New Multiple Range Test (DNMRT) at the 5% level to see which treatments are different. Results: The biscuits selected based on organoleptic tests were F1 biscuits with a water content of 3.1%, ash 1.5%, protein 5.2%, fat 3%, magnesium 117 gr, anthocyanin 14.88 mg. Conclusion: Biscuits substituted for mackerel fish flour and black rice flour can be used as an alternative snack for diabetes mellitus sufferers.Keywords: diabetes mellitus, biscuits, mackerel flour, black rice flour

Abstract

Tujuan: Mengetahui angka dan jenis bakteri udara, lantai, dan meja berdasarkan pewarnaan Gram di laboratorium Mikroskopik Fakultas Kedokteran Universitas Tanjungpura. Metode: Penelitian ini menggunakan metode settling plate, selama 15 menit dengan media agar darah untuk sampel bakteri udara. Sampel lantai dan meja diambil menggunakan swab lidi kapas steril dengan cairan buffer phospate, kemudian digores pada media agar darah. Semua media sampel diinkubasi pada suhu 36℃ selama 24 jam, kemudian dilakukan penghitungan koloni serta pewarnaan Gram untuk melihat variasi jenis bakterinya. Hasil: Angka bakteri udara tertinggi adalah 208,33 CFU/m3, dan yang paling rendah 52,08 CFU/m3.  Dari pewarnaan Gram, bentuk morfologi bakteri udara yaitu kokkus Gram positif dan negatif, serta basil Gram negatif. Sedangkan angka bakteri swab permukaan lantai dan meja yang paling tinggi adalah 200 CFU/m2, terendah adalah 18 CFU/m2. Morfologi bakteri permukaan lantai dan meja yang paling banyak yaitu diplobasil Gram negatif. Kesimpulan: Rata – rata angka bakteri udara laboratorium Mikroskopik adalah 52,08 CFU/m3, dan masih memenuhi standar nilai batas yang ditetapkan. Rata-rata angka bakteri swab permukaan adalah 64 CFU/m2 yang cukup tinggi, melebihi standar nilai batas permukaan dinding dan lantai ruang perawatan yang ditetapkan oleh Kepmenkes.
